YiLuProxy和Maskfog指纹浏览器配置

本文档详细介绍了如何配置YiLuProxy代理服务,包括设置代理端口、端口转发和代理规则,并提供了Maskfog浏览器的配置步骤,包括新建配置文件、输入代理信息以及检查代理连接状态,确保安全稳定的网络浏览体验。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>

目录

1.YiLu代理配置

2.Maskfog浏览器配置


1.YiLuProxy配置


①配置 YiLuProxy设置
代理端口:随机或自定义,如1080;
端口转发:根据自己的需要设置端口范围,这里我设置5500-5510;
绑定地址:127.0.0.1;
代理引擎设置:选择“其他代理工具”;
代理规则:选择第二条和第四条规则;
然后别忘了保存!


②端口转发
请查看网页:https://yilu.us/configuration/local-port-forwarding

2.Maskfog浏览器配置


在 Maskfog 浏览器上,单击“新建配置文件”。


然后输入浏览器配置文件名称,选择操作系统、浏览器版本和用户代理。

### DrissionPage与指纹浏览器的关系 DrissionPage 是基于 Playwright Selenium 的 Python 库,旨在简化 Web 自动化操作。对于指纹浏览器的支持兼容性而言,主要取决于底层驱动程序的能力。 #### 指纹浏览器特性支持 指纹浏览器通过模拟真实用户的设备特征来规避检测机制。为了实现这一点,这类浏览器通常会修改 User-Agent 字符串、屏幕分辨率以及其他可能被用来识别自动化行为的属性[^1]。 #### 兼容性考量 当使用 DrissionPage 进行自动化时,可以通过配置选项调整浏览器实例的行为以匹配指纹浏览器的要求: - **User-Agent 设置**:可以自定义启动参数设置特定的 User-Agent。 ```python from drission.page import ChromiumPage page = ChromiumPage( browser_type='chromium', user_data_dir='/path/to/user/data', launch_options={'args': ['--user-agent=Mozilla/5.0 (Windows NT 10.0; Win64; x64)...']} ) ``` - **窗口大小控制**:可通过 API 调整浏览器窗口尺寸,模仿不同设备类型的显示效果。 ```python page.set_window_size(1920, 1080) ``` - **JavaScript 执行环境定制**:允许注入脚本改变 navigator 对象中的属性值,从而更好地伪装成真人访问者。 ```javascript await page.evaluateOnNewDocument(() => { Object.defineProperty(navigator, 'webdriver', {get: () => undefined}); }); ``` 这些措施有助于提高与指纹浏览器之间的兼容性交互体验,使得利用 DrissionPage 开展的任务更加隐蔽且难以被目标网站察觉到自动化痕迹。
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值